Tomorrow, we are also excited to partner with Wild Ones (formerly Blue Ridge Conservation) to begin planting a native garden at the front of campus. These gardens are not only intended to beautify our campus but also to support pollinators in our area. Once established, native gardens do not require intensive weeding or maintenance, which is also a bonus. This first garden will be at the front of campus, around the flagpole, and we hope to continue our partnership with Wild Ones to install more gardens in the future.
